Establish Credibility
Printing and distributing your company’s performance report, including financial analysis, employee retention statistics, and impact statements, can help build trust with your associates. Transparency also displays your commitment to accountability to shareholders and investors. For non-profits, an annual report showcases your organization’s credibility by revealing how donations were distributed and their impact.
By reviewing an annual report, potential for-profit investors can evaluate your business’s potential. Their decision-making is often influenced by a report’s analysis of financial gain when buying, holding, or selling company shares. Through these reports, investors and stakeholders can understand the company’s standing and growth possibility, helping them make informed decisions.

Outline Corporate Governance
Annual reports often outline information about a company’s governing team and the board of directors. Providing this information helps highlight business developments, such as expansion into new markets. It also identifies corporate governance ethics, further promoting accountability. Including information about the board of directors in a printed annual report may help hiring teams or investors identify conflicts of interest or gauge the company’s commitment to ethical decision-making. Some organizations may use a published annual report as a recruitment tool. The report’s board listing may attract future members or investors.
